Marcus Whitman Beats Pal-Mac in Double OT

Thursday: DAY IN REVIEW: There were eight games played today and more mismatches, but the Pal-Mac at Marcus Whitman game broke that mold with a double overtime win for the Wildcats.

Pal-Mac at Marcus WhitmanMarcus Whitman started with a 2-1 first quarter and the scoring was reversed in the second so that the teams were tied at 3-3 at the half. The Wildcats took a two-goal lead at the start of the third, but Pal-Mac came back with one leaving the score in favor of Marcus Whitman at 6-4 after three quarters. The Wildcats scored at 7:54 in the last quarter giving them a two-goal lead but on the next faceoff Quinn Nolan scored from the draw and less than two minutes later he scored again to tie the game at 6-6. In the first overtime both teams had control of an offensive set, but although Marcus Whitman did not get a shot on cage, Pal-Mac did and Wildcat senior goalie Robert Craine (10s/6ga=63% in 56 mins) made a big save. The game progressed to the second overtime where senior midfielder Aidan Royston scored the game winner for the Wildcats at 1:26. Royston had 2g along with Connor Tomion and Connor Gorton had 1g-2a for Marcus Whitman (9-1). For Pal-Mac, Nolan had 2g-2a and won 14/15 draws. Junior goalie Will Nichols had 8s/7ga (53%) for the Red Raiders (7-2). [BOX SCORE]  More photos are in the gallery.
